I wanted to see if I could improve on my score.

more power (impedance raise is an important factor) and another box with switchable ports (around cars resonance freq).

I'm definitely building another box, and the switchable ports is a really good idea! TY!

As for the impedance raise, my subs are D2 ohm, and the voice coils are wired in series, subs are parallel, for a 2 ohm final impedance. Which is where my amp is limited, it's only stable down to 2 ohms. But I'm open to suggestions.

Is there a way to wire them differently, and get better results?
